Transaction 52c59da818016462b176dc853ab200297d3e3cf3be623f6918f80a45a4672607

1 Input
2 Outputs
  • 52c59da818016462b176dc853ab200297d3e3cf3be623f6918f80a45a4672607:0
  • value  65951
    address  3QorXXgRRgBtsGSAhNrUjjLzuhXXfaNc9e
  • 52c59da818016462b176dc853ab200297d3e3cf3be623f6918f80a45a4672607:1
  • value  3496507
    address  1JGY22oio3HxZLmdRSDDVzLhpeVJ98DZ8D